Itching to do a DIY project? You can construct the tree house below on your own! Do consider the health, maturity, and strength of the tree you plan on building your fort on. The main difference between building a tree house and an actual house is that a house relies on a foundation, while a tree house is built on a platform. The platform should be sturdy enough to hold everything atop it. At the same time, it should minimize damage to the tree and keep it from swaying on a windy day.
